One of the things as a wedding designer I like to use is products from the family. For this theme you could use quilts,old cowboy boots filled with flowers, old buckets with flowers, spurs rusted containers and vintage canning jars. I did a rehearsal a few years ago with this theme and it was beautiful! Good luck and enjoy your wonderful day!

Oh believe me, I know all about ultra-budgeting. The keys are ebay, Wal-Mart, Hobby Lobby and thrift stores. Do as much as you can yourself. You can make your own invitations, decorations, anything you feel capable of making.

Yeah, catalogs are going to be way overpriced. The problem with wedding items is that most distributers will charge three times what something is worth just because the word "wedding" is attached to it. It's great to get ideas and inspiration from them, but I definitely don't recommend ordering form them unless it's something ultra unique that you can't make or find anywhere else and you really, really want.
